Blunder 3: Poor Testimonial Management
Successful review management is important not just for developing reputation with customers, but likewise for affecting your Google rank. Actually, online assessments represent almost a fifth of the aspects that calculate location based search engine rankings. Furthermore, neglecting adverse responses can have significant consequences, as nearly half of consumers are much more likely to shop at a small business that proactively addresses and responds to criticism.Overlooking undesirable comments can have a destructive influence on a firm's online image of customers, approximately 85% of potential customers, place equal trust in personal suggestions and online evaluations. To enhance location based search engine optimization and boost consumer interaction, carry out an evaluation managing approach that invites clients to leave critiques and reacts without delay to both favorable and adverse customer reviews.
Check that your Google My Business listing is current which you're showcasing testimonials on your business website, as 64% of customers claim they're more probable to rely on an organization with consumer testimonials on its internet site.
Error 4: Absolutely No Google Posts
After tackling the importance of review management, it's time to turn your focus to an additional often-overlooked facet of location based search engine optimization: Google Posts. By not using Google Posts, you're missing out on a prime opportunity to increase your search visibility and engagement with local area consumers. Google Posts make it possible for you to share updates straight on Google Search and Maps, showcasing your experience and creating client trust.Regularly posting updates pertinent to your target market is crucial, as it not only increases involvement it likewise drives conversions with clear call-to-actions like "Reserve Now" or "Learn More".
Incorporating your Google Business Profile with your business website is likewise vital for local search optimization. By posting consistently on Google My Business, you can boost the freshness and relevance of your online ranking, enhancing your possibilities of appearing in the coveted Google Local Pack.
With Google Posts, you can improve your location based SEO, drive even more web traffic and conversions, and stay ahead of rivals. Companies that post consistently see a typical increase of 10% in involvement and 5% in bookings, according to Google.
Blunder 5: Incorrect Name, Address, Phone Number Information
Establishing a consistent digital footprint is vital for local organizations, and it starts with ensuring that their service name, address, and telephone number are continually provided across the internet. Inconsistencies in this info can trigger confusion amongst search engines and possible customers, inevitably leading to diminished online rankings and fewer web site visitors. Study from Moz reveals that incorrect company listings can have a substantial effect, with a staggering 41% decrease in search engine positionings for companies with erroneous or inconsistent on line visibility. Avoid this mistake by regularly examining your service's name, address and phone number (NAP) details on various online networks, such as Google My Business listings, web directory sites and your business's main site.To make sure uniformity and correctness, make use of citation management resources such as Moz Local, BrightLocal, or Whitespark to keep track of and modify on-line listings, fixing any disparities in your company's name, address and contact number (NAP) data. It's important to maintain harmony across all systems, including standard formatting of addresses and telephone number, to stop prospective complication and errors.
Standardizing your service's name, address, and contact number (NAP) across the internet can boost local internet search engine rankings by as long as 15%, study by BrightLocal reveals. Making sure NAP uniformity and precision is important for constructing trust with prospective consumers and preventing missed out on possibilities. To make the most of on the internet presence, routinely evaluation and improve your NAP details to guarantee exact representation in online search engine outcomes.
